About the FIEO

The Federation of Indian Export Organisations (FIEO) is an organization established in 1965 by the Ministry of Commerce to promote and support Indian exports. Registered under the Societies Registration Act XXI of 1860, it is an organization that connects various entities involved in Indian exports, including the exporters, the government, financial institutions, railways, ports, etc., that are part of the export trade facilitation.

 It has provided a wide range of services to assist Indian exporters in navigating the complex global trade environment.

Role of FIEO in Export Trade

Below are some of the roles of FIEO in export trade for exporters such as:

1. Representative of the Indian Exporters

FIEO advocates for the needs of Indian exporters before the Indian government, voicing their grievances. It reviews, authorizes, and recommends the government’s import-export policies, seeking the best interests of the Indian exporters.

2. Platform for Global Reach

It organizes trade fairs and arranges media, publications, etc., that showcase Indian export products, helping the exporters expand globally.

3. Maintains Beneficial Global Relations

It maintains good relationships with many international entities that play important roles in international trade, such as the International Monetary Fund and the World Trade Organization.

4. Sponsor

FIEO can sponsor Indian exporters under various headings, such as Market Development Assistance grants and reimbursement of travel expenses for services related to India’s consultancy.

Core Services of the FIEO

The core services of the Federation of Indian Export Organization (FIEO) include providing guidance and support to Indian exporters through providing various core services such as:

1. Trade Promotion

One of the crucial services that the FIEO provides is the activities directed toward promoting exports. Several activities are undertaken to ensure India’s magnetic presence in the global markets, making it one of the major players in the global markets.

They are primarily focused on enhancing the visibility of Indian products and services in international markets and facilitating the establishment of profitable trade relationships. Some of these activities are:

  • Export Facilitation

The FIEO helps Indian exporters identify lucrative export opportunities. It analyses global trends, demand patterns, and competitors’ landscapes to assist Indian exporters in bringing their products into global markets. It also helps identify potential markets that align with their product offerings, which can help maximize their chances of success.

  • Trade Fairs and Exhibitions

The FIEO organizes and participates in trade fairs, providing a platform for Indian exporters to showcase their products to a global audience. It helps them build a network with potential buyers and secure business deals. The FIEO ensures that Indian export products are well-represented at these events, which enhances their international visibility.

  • Buyer-Seller Meeting

The FIEO organizes buyer-seller meetings to provide a structured environment for Indian exporters to engage directly with international buyers. By fostering direct interactions, the FIEO helps bridge the gap between supply and demand and leads to fruitful business collaborations.

2. Capacity Building

A skilled and knowledgeable workforce is crucial to any successful export venture. Recognizing its importance, FIEO places a strong emphasis on capacity building. It organizes various programs aiming to build the capabilities of the Indian exporters. Some of them include:

  • Training programs

The FIEO organizes a variety of training programs that are online as well as offline. Some of the topics dealt with in these training programs are:

International trade

A five-day web conference was arranged that provided a practical approach to understanding exports and imports. This course benefited single-proprietary businesses, small businesses, and large corporations.

Starting Export Business

A five-day online training program was arranged to guide many entrepreneurs in starting their export businesses and help them navigate the labyrinth of global market compliances.

Role of Digital Market in Business Growth

A four-day online training program helped the trainees understand the importance of digitalization in the success of exports. It educated them on the use of it in expanding their business.

FIEO offers internships for students from universities doing management studies. The head office takes 4 students, and the regional offices admit 2 students every year. The internships help the students gain insight into the trade complexities and learn to navigate them.

  • Skill Development

FIEO takes several initiatives aimed at skill development that help to increase the competitiveness of Indian exporters in global markets. These initiatives include workshops on emerging trade trends, digital marketing, and supply chain management. These initiatives help Indian exporters to stay ahead of the curve in a rapidly evolving market.

  • E-learning Platforms

Several online courses made available by the FIEO provide convenient access to training materials, certifications, and resources, enabling exporters to work on their skills at their own pace. These e-learning platforms benefit small and medium-sized enterprises with limited access to traditional training programs.

3. Information Dissemination

Being updated with the trade landscape information is very important while carrying out export practices. FIEO provides access to accurate and timely information that helps the exporters to make informed decisions. There are various channels through which they offer it. Some of them are enlisted below:

  • Market Intelligence Reports

FIEO provides Market Intelligence reports that provide crucial insights into global market trends, demand-supply scenarios, and competitor strategies. These reports are especially beneficial for exporters entering new markets or looking forward to expanding their businesses further. It helps exporters better align their strategies with global trends.

  • Export Guides and Handbooks

FIEO publishes various export guides and handbooks that provide step-by-step instructions on various aspects of the export process, including product classification, tariff structures, and customs procedures. These guides help simplify the export process, making it more accessible to businesses of all sizes.

  • Trade Alerts

The FIEO issues trade alerts informing exporters about international trade policies, tariffs, and regulations. These alerts help exporters adhere to trade norms and avoid disruptions to their business practices.

4. Advisory Services

FIEO provides a wide range of advisory services to help exporters navigate the legal, regulatory, and financial aspects of international trade. These services include:

  • Legal and Regulatory Advice

FIEO helps exporters understand the legal implications of their trade activities. It also guides them in complying with international trade laws, protecting intellectual property rights, and resolving disputes.

  • Customs and Excise Assistance

FIEO helps exporters navigate complex customs regulations, manage documentation, and take advantage of duty drawbacks. It streamlines their operations and reduces the risk of delays and penalties.

5. Miscellaneous Services

The organization provides some other miscellaneous services like:

  • It publishes a weekly bulletin with the latest information about international trade developments.
  • It provides free access to the Indian trade portal, which offers information about Preferential tariffs, SPS/TBT, import statistics of 87 countries, and India’s contribution to imports.
  • It provides an online chat service that helps to address exporters’ questions related to brand management, trademarks, copyrights, corporate legal affairs, etc.
  • It also provides FOREX services like Forward calculator, Forward rates, Spot rates, etc.

Membership of FIEO under RCMC

Membership of FIEO is availed by obtaining an RCMC (Registration-cum-Membership Certificate). Several benefits follow after obtaining an RCMC. These are as follows:

  1. There are several concessions and benefits that the exporter can avail under the Foreign Trade Policy.
  2. After registering for RCMC, the exporter becomes a part of the worldwide network of exporters and importers.
  3. They participate in international exhibitions and trade fairs, which help these exporters expand globally and showcase their products in international markets.
  4. The certificate holders become eligible for various government schemes and incentives as well.

Obtaining RCMC Registration will help in getting membership of FIEO which grants exporters access to a global network, enabling the exporter’s ability to expand their business internationally,

Documents for RCMC Registration for Exporters

Exporters not registered with the Export Promotion Council are eligible for RCMC registration. The documents required for the RCMC registration are:

  1. Import Export Code
  2. Provide a copy of the Pan Card
  3. Ensure your business is compliant with GST by submitting a GST registration certificate.
  4. A Bank statement
  5. Articles of Association, Memorandum of Association, Partnership deed or Trust deed.
  6. SSI/IEM certificate (in case of manufacturing goods)

One can register for RCMC online. For this purpose, one must visit the Directorate General of Foreign Trade portal. One must select the “E-RCMC” option in the services section. Before applying for the RCMC, you must have an Import Export Code.

One can obtain this online from the same portal itself. Once the IEC is obtained, there is no need to renew it. However, RCMC requires it to be renewed. The members of the FIEO get to discuss their concerns with the higher authorities concerning excise, customs or with the Directorate General of Foreign Trade.
